You Can Remember?

You na take time to read the article dem in this year Watchtower? Let see whether you able to answer this question dem:

Wetin mon move us to give honor to Jehovah?

We can give honor to Jehovah because we really respect him and love him. We can also give Jehovah honor because we want other people to know him.—w25.01, p. 3.

When somebody make us feel bad, wetin will help us to always be ready to forgive them?

We mon not pretend like everything alright or we not feeling bad. When we stop keeping grudge, it can help us to not always be vex. We will also be doing good for ourself.—w25.02, pp. 15-16.

What good example Mark set da young brother dem can follow?

Mark wor willing to accept the assignment to serve other people. When Paul refuse to carry him on his second missionary trip, maybe Mark wor feeling bad. But it not discourage him from doing more for his brother and sister dem.—w25.04, p. 27.

What Jesus mean when he say: “I na show your name to them”? (John 17:26)

His disciple dem already know God name da Jehovah. But he wor talking about the kindna person Jehovah is. He wanted them to know Jehovah purpose, what He na do, what He will do and the good-good way dem He get.—w25.05, pp. 20-21.

When we humble, wetin it will make us to remember?

We will remember da we not know some thing dem. For example, we not know the time the end will come or the main way Jehovah will help us during da time. And we not know what will happen tomorrow or we not understand everything about the way Jehovah know us.—w25.06, pp. 15-18.

Wetin will help us to benefit when we read any article or listen to any public talk?

Maybe you can ask yourself this question dem: ‘What proof they using to convince the people da listening? Any good example there da I can use to teach somebody the truth? Who will get interest in this topic?’—w25.07, p. 19.

Wetin we can learn from the way Jehovah forgive David?

Even though David make some serious mistake dem in his life, but when he show da he really repent from his heart, Jehovah forgive him. (1 Ki. 9:​4, 5) When Jehovah forgive our sin, he can forget about it. Da mean he can’t punish us for it in the future.—w25.08, p. 17.

Wetin we mon do if the Bible student finding it hard to understand certain thing?

If he finding it hard to understand certain thing, don’t force it. Yor can pass by it and make plan to come back to it later on.—w25.09, p. 24.

The Bible say da sin get the power to fool us. (Heb. 3:13) How it can do it?

Because we not perfect, we can do wrong things. Beside da one, it can also make us to continue to think da Jehovah not love us.—w25.10, p. 16.

What three thing dem we can do da will help us pray to Jehovah from our heart?

(1) We can think good-good about Jehovah quality dem. (2) We can think about the problem dem we going through and pray about it. We can also think about somebody da we suppose to forgive. (3) Take your own time when you praying. This one will help us to tell Jehovah what really in our heart and how we feeling.—w25.10, pp. 19-20.

How we can help our older brother and sister dem in the congregation?

We mon always visit and call our older brother and sister dem. When they get appointment with the doctor, we can try to go with them. Or we can find time to go field service together.—w25.11, pp. 6-7.

What some important thing dem we can do to plan wedding da will honor Jehovah?

Obey the law from the government. Your wedding mon show respect for Jehovah. Wear clothes da will not stumble people and make sure to not follow any custom da against the Bible. And when yor planning the wedding, yor mon talk about what two of yor want.—w25.12, pp. 21-24.
